In the debut episode of Lit NYC, the FAQ NYC Podcast Network's off-cycle show covering books, art, music and more, you'll be hearing from Ross Perlin, author of the brilliant Language City: The Fight to Preserve Endangered Mother Tongues, and co-director of the Endangered Languages Alliance.

He sat down at the Alliance's office in Manhattan to talk with Haidee Chu, Queens reporter for The City and a native Cantonese speaker, and monolingual Harry Siegel, to discuss his work mapping the languages spoken here in what may be the most linguistically diverse city in the history of the world, why our melting pot is also a threat to some of those languages, and much more.
